D Bennett Jewellers Limited Overview
D Bennett Jewellers Limited is a live company located in south yorkshire, DN4 5FB with a Companies House number of 05683378. It operates in the other retail sale in non-specialised stores sector, SIC Code 47190. Founded in January 2006, it's largest shareholder is mr david john bennett with a 60% stake. D Bennett Jewellers Limited is a established, micro s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£361.7k with declining growth in recent years.
